Under state law, the N.C. Department of Labor is responsible for promoting the health, safety and general well-being of more than 4 million workers. The laws and programs the department administers affect every worker--and virtually every person--in the state.  More information can be found at http://www.dol.state.nc.us/.

Posters
Businesses seeking labor law posters may call a toll-free number to order the publications at no charge and avoid paying private companies for the information. The number is 1-800-LABOR-NC. The posters, which contain updated information, will be mailed at no charge. Poster information may also be viewed on the Department of Labor web site at http://www.nclabor.com/pubs.htm#Posters. (order code 1400)  Posters combine labor law posting requirements under state occupational safety and health lows, wage and hour laws and employment security laws. Employers are required to display the posters in their businesses where workers can see them. Although employers are required to display the posters, they are not required to purchase them. Some poster companies have sent notices out to employers attempting to sell the information. Advertisements have asked for as much as $50 for information contained in the posters. The ads often maintain that paying for the poster is better than paying the fine for not having the poster displayed. The labor law posters are FREE. Do not pay for them!
